Barback Salary in Toledo, OH
Barbacks in Toledo, OH, in 2026, earn approximately $12.50 per hour, which translates to about $500.00 per week, $2,166.67 per month, and $26,000.00 per year.
The job market for Barbacks in Toledo is growing modestly at a rate of 2% per year, indicating a positive trend in demand within the hospitality and bar service industries.
How Much Does a Barback Make in Toledo, OH?
The salary of a Barback in Toledo varies by experience and employer, with entry-level workers earning less and experienced Barbacks commanding higher pay. Here's a breakdown by level:
| Experience level | Hourly pay | Weekly pay | Monthly pay | Yearly pay |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Entry-level (~25th percentile) | $10.00 | $400.00 | $1,733.33 | $20,800.00 |
| Mid-level (average) | $12.50 | $500.00 | $2,166.67 | $26,000.00 |
| Top earners (90th percentile) | $15.00 | $600.00 | $2,600.00 | $31,200.00 |
Do Barbacks in Toledo Earn Tips?
Yes, Barbacks in Toledo typically earn tips in addition to their base pay. They can make approximately $5 to $10 extra per hour in tips depending on the establishment and shift, which can significantly boost their overall earnings.
Barback Salary in Toledo vs. National Average
Nationally, the average Barback earns about $14.80 per hour, which totals roughly $30,784 per year.
In Toledo, Barbacks earn slightly less on average at $12.50 per hour and $26,000 yearly. This difference can be explained by local economic factors and cost of living.

What Influences a Barback’s Salary in Toledo?
Several factors contribute to the salary variation among Barbacks in Toledo:
- Experience: More experienced Barbacks usually command higher wages and better tips.
- Skills: Efficient and reliable Barbacks who can multitask and quickly assist Bartenders often earn more.
- Type of Establishment: Upscale bars or busy nightclubs tend to pay better and offer more tips than casual venues.
- Shift Timing: Night and weekend shifts may offer higher hourly pay or tip potential.
- Local Economy: Toledo’s specific market conditions affect wages in hospitality roles.
How To Become a Barback in Toledo
Becoming a successful Barback in Toledo involves several important steps:
- Get Basic Training: Enroll in programs like the Owens Community College Culinary Arts Program, which includes beverage management skills beneficial for Barbacks.
- Attend Specialized Schools: Toledo Bartending School offers practical courses focused on bartending and barbacking skills.
- Earn Required Certifications: Ohio-specific credentials such as the Ohio Alcohol Server Knowledge (ASK) Certification and the nationally recognized ServSafe Alcohol Certification are vital for legal compliance and preferred by employers.
- Gain Experience: Starting as a bar helper or in other hospitality roles can build valuable knowledge and connections.
